Product Description Fig and Vanilla Hand Wash and Hand Cream Duo Set has a gentle earthy scent of fig coupled with a soft and delicate scent of vanilla. The fresh and earthy tones of this delicious fruit accompanied by a soft sweetness of vanilla will leave your hands feeling squeaky clean and deeply moisturised. Our hand wash is free from any nasties. Free from Parabens, SLS, MI and MCI Sulphates. Great for men and women, suitable for daily use and perfect for leaving your hands fresh and clean, locking in moisture. Figs have long been revered as an aphrodisiac and whilst we are under no illusion that a hand cream can stimulate carnal desires, it is worth noting that figs are rich in oils and have anti-oxidant properties which can help reverse damage in the skin. Infused with the earthy wild fig aroma accompanied with a soft subtle soothing vanilla scent, you can leave in your bathroom for guests to enjoy. Ingredients Fig and vanilla handwash: Aqua, Coco-Glucoside, Lauryl Glucoside, Cocamidopropyl Betaine, Parfum, Glycerin, Tocopherol, Benzyl Alcohol, Phenoxyethanol, Potassium Sorbate, Citric Acid, Hydrolyzed Wheat Protein, Sodium Benzoate, Geraniol, Hexyl Cinnamal, Isoeugenol, Butylphenyl Methylpropional Citronellol, Linalool. Fig and vanilla hand cream: Aqua, Prunus Dulcis (sweet almond oil), Cetearyl Alcohol, Glyceryl Stearate, Phenoxyethanl, Buxus Chinesis (Jojoba Oil), Parfum (Perfume), Tocopherol (Vitamin E), Glycerin, Mel (Honey), Sodium Lactate, Ethylhexyglycerin, Xanthan Gum, Geraniol, Hexy Cinnamal, Isoeugenol, Butylphenyl Methylpropional, Citonellol, Linalool.
